The modern new funicular which now ferries visitors up to the old Cape Point lighthouse. It is also called the Flying Dutchman. Named after the legend of a ghostly ship that is reputed to sail around the Point.
Entry to Cape Point now costs R85 for adults :shock: and R30 for kids.
